Frequently Asked Questions
Does the Guitar Include a Gig Bag or Case?
The product specifications do not explicitly indicate the inclusion of a gig bag or case. Prospective purchasers should anticipate acquiring separate protection to guarantee the instrument remains secure for its intended beneficiaries and future use.
What Type of Pickup System Is Installed?
Regrettably, for those wishing to amplify their service through music, this instrument lacks electronic augmentation. The PC15 is purely acoustic, offering a resonant voice that remains naturally tethered to its spruce top, requiring external microphones for projection.
Is the Ibanez PC15 Suitable for Fingerstyle Playing?
The Ibanez PC15’s comfortable Grand Concert body style and balanced tonal qualities render it suitable for fingerstyle playing.
It offers the precision and responsiveness required to serve musicians favoring this intricate, nuanced technique.
What Accessories Are Included in the Box?
Documentation indicates the package includes only the instrument itself.
Prospective purchasers should note that essentials for immediate playability, such as a gig bag or tuner, are not included and will need to be acquired separately.
Is This a Full-Size or 3/4 Scale Guitar?
The instrument is a full-scale guitar, featuring a standard 25-inch scale length that guarantees comfortable playability for adult learners or dedicated players.
